Policies
PRE-PRODUCTION: Jane Cole LLC provides estimates, free of charge, for any and all jobs, upon request.
For first time clients a credit card hold/authorization is required. (click here for credit authorization document)
For new and current clients booking any single job with an invoice that totals over $10,000.00, the client shall provide 50% of the total invoice amount to Jane Cole LLC prior to the start of production. (click here for credit authorization document) The remaining balance shall be due within 30 days of receipt of the final invoice.
Jane Cole LLC applies Net 30 terms to all payments due for services provided. Unless a prior arrangement has been made before the start of production, in writing, signed by both parties, Jane Cole LLC will apply a late payment fee of 5% of the outstanding invoice for clients failing to pay their balance within 30 days.
PRODUCTION: Production day rates are based on a 10-hour day, including travel time, with a minimum of 45 minutes break time per 10-hour day. For billing purposes, a 10-hour day shall be defined as any production consisting of more than 4 hours of consecutive work. Any production consisting of less than 4 hours of consecutive work, including travel time, will be billed at 50% of the standard day rate. Any production consisting of more than 4 hours of work, including travel time, will be billed at 100% of the standard day rate. Any production consisting of more than 10 hours of production will be billed at 150% of the standard day rate.
CANCELLATIONS: All shoots must be canceled at least 24 hours before that start of production. A shoot that is canceled later than 24 hours before the start of production will be billed 100% of the estimated cost of production.
POST-PRODUCTION: Post-Production day rates are based on a 8-hour day. Rush jobs that require more than 8 hours of editing per day will be billed on a case-by-case basis, with the rate to be determined by the producer and approved by the client before the start of post-production.
PROMOTIONAL USE: Jane Cole LLC reserves the right to reserves the right to exhibit any and all footage, graphics and audio produced in-house, for promotional purposes only, and to distribute said promotional materials through its website and via DVD or tape based show reels, UNLESS an exclusive distribution/ownership agreement is specified by the client in advance.
CORRECTIONS: If a correction to the edit is required due to a technical error, it will be reconciled by Jane Cole LLC at no additional charge to the client. If a correction to the edit is required due to TASTE, the correction(s) will be billed at the standard editing and/or graphic design day rate that applies to that particular job, as specified in the estimate. Taste corrections shall include, but not be limited to: change in length from original agreed-upon length, change of music, additional graphics, color correction (if not requested in original invoice), format conversion, replacement of footage, replacement of dialogue (ADR), additional sound effects, additional hard copies, additional uploads of corrected materials to client FTP.
RENTAL: All renters will be required to either a) have a certificate of insurance at the time of rental or b) pay the full rental price upfront. All renters will be required to sign Jane Cole LLC rental paperwork and to leave a copy of their driver’s license on file before taking any equipment off premises.
Equipment rental rates are billed for any 24 hour period, or part thereof, in which the equipment is dedicated to the service of a particular client and unavailable to the staff of Jane Cole LLC for other use. This includes travel days. Equipment traveling to or from a shoot will be billed at 100% of the standard day rate, per day, or part thereof, in which the equipment is on-set or in transit to/from set.
